P. 1/6 Part Number: XZM2CRKDGKCBD107S-IC 5.0 x 5.0 mm Surface Mount LED Lamp Handling Precautions Compare to epoxy encapsulant that is hard and brittle, silicone is softer and flexible. Although its characteristic significantly reduces thermal stress, it is more susceptible to damage by external mechanical force. As a result, special handling precautions need to be observed during assembly using silicone encapsulated LED products. Failure to comply might lead to damage and premature failure of the LED. 1. Handle the component along the side surfaces by using forceps or appropriate tools. 2. Do not directly touch or handle the silicone lens surface. It may damage the internal circuitry. 3. Do not stack together assembled PCBs containing exposed LEDs. Impact may scratch the silicone lens or damage the internal circuitry. 4.1. The inner diameter of the SMD pickup nozzle should not exceed the size of the LED to prevent air leaks. 4.2. A pliable material is suggested for the nozzle tip to avoid scratching or damaging the LED surface during pickup. 4.3. The dimensions of the component must be accurately programmed in the pick-and-place machine to insure precise pickup and avoid damage during production. 5. As silicone encapsulation is permeable to gases, some corrosive substances such as H2S might corrode silver plating of leadframe. P. 3/6 Part Number: XZM2CRKDGKCBD107S-IC 5.0 x 5.0 mm Surface Mount LED Lamp Data Transfer Time (TH+TL=1.25µs±600ns) T0H 0 code, high voltage time 0.3µs ±150ns T1H 1 code, high voltage time 0.6µs ±150ns T0L 0 code, low voltage time 0.9µs ±150ns T1L 1 code, low voltage time 0.6µs ±150ns RES low voltage time 80µs - Sequence Chart Cascade Method Data Transmission Method Typical Application Circuit Note: The data of D1 is sent by MCU, and D2,D3,D4 through pixel internal reshaping amplification to transmit. Composition of 24bit Data G7 G6 G5 G4 G3 G2 G1 G0 R7 R6 R5 R4 Note: Follow the order of GRB to send data and the high bit is sent first.
